Engineered Bacteria‐Vesicle Delivered Lactate Reprogramming Boosts Tumor Radiosensitivity
We engineered a bacterial‐vesicular dual‐delivery platform that targets LOx to colorectal tumors, enabling lactate clearance, immune microenvironment remodeling, and microbiota modulation. This microbe–metabolism synergistic strategy effectively sensitizes colorectal cancer to radiotherapy, offering a promising approach to overcome radioresistance ...
